Educator Lora Caudill, native San Pedran, shares how as Principal of Leland Street Elementary School she was able involve and serve the large population of military family students at the second oldest elementary school in San Pedro; and explains some of the unique needs these students have.
Lora has been an educator and administrator with numerous positions throughout the Los Angeles Unified School District (LAUSD) for nearly 25 years. She began teaching fifth grade science, then promoted to Literacy Coach at Century Park Elementary in Inglewood, became Instructional Coach and Categorical Program Advisor at Cabrillo Avenue Elementary School and principal of Leland Street Elementary School (both in San Pedro) where she was commended for her work with military families and honored in Washington, D.D. She was promoted to Equity Director for LAUSD then returned to campus life currently principal of Van Deene STEAM Academy now magnate campus.
